Step 2: Create or Modify Block Structure
For New Blocks:
-
Create the block directory and files:
mkdir -p blocks/{block-name}
touch blocks/{block-name}/{block-name}.js
touch blocks/{block-name}/{block-name}.css
-
Basic JavaScript structure:
export default async function decorate(block) {
}
-
Basic CSS structure:
main .{block-name} {
}
For Existing Blocks:
- Locate the block directory:
blocks/{block-name}/
- Review current implementation:
curl http://localhost:3000/{test-content-path}
- Understand existing decoration logic and styles
Step 3: Implement JavaScript Decoration
Essential pattern — re-use existing DOM elements:
export default async function decorate(block) {
const picture = block.querySelector('picture');
const heading = block.querySelector('h2');
const figure = document.createElement('figure');
figure.append(picture);
const wrapper = document.createElement('div');
wrapper.className = 'content-wrapper';
wrapper.append(heading, figure);
block.replaceChildren(wrapper);
if (block.classList.contains('carousel')) {
setupCarousel(block);
}
}

Step 4: Add CSS Styling
Essential patterns — scoped, responsive, using custom properties:
main .my-block {
background-color: var(--background-color);
color: var(--text-color);
font-family: var(--body-font-family);
max-width: var(--max-content-width);
padding: 1rem;
flex-direction: column;
}
main .my-block h2 {
font-family: var(--heading-font-family);
font-size: var(--heading-font-size-m);
}
main .my-block .item {
display: flex;
gap: 1rem;
}
@media (width >= 600px) {
main .my-block {
padding: 2rem;
}
}
@media (width >= 900px) {
main .my-block {
flex-direction: row;
padding: 4rem;
}
}
main .my-block.dark {
background-color: var(--dark-color);
color: var(--clr-white);
}

When Modifying Core Files
If your changes require modifying core files (scripts.js, styles.css, delayed.js):
Common core files:
- scripts.js — Decoration utilities, auto-blocking logic, page loading
- styles/styles.css — Global styles (eager), CSS custom properties
- styles/lazy-styles.css — Global styles (lazy loaded)
- scripts/delayed.js — Marketing, analytics, third-party integrations
Key principles:
- Make core changes first (before block changes that depend on them)
- Test core changes independently with existing content before using them in blocks
- Consider impact — core changes can affect multiple blocks/pages
- Test thoroughly — verify no regressions in existing functionality
- Keep it minimal — only add what's necessary
- Document with code comments — most core changes don't need separate docs
- NEVER modify
scripts/aem.js — it's platform-provided and upgradable
Testing core changes:
- Test with existing content URLs that use affected functionality
- For auto-blocking: test pages that should/shouldn't trigger it
- For global styles: test across multiple blocks and pages
- Check console for errors
- Verify responsive behavior
